If 62% of 80 classmates like hip-hop, but 70% of 60 relatives like hip-hop, which one is more?

Oliga [24]2 years ago
8 0
62% of 80 is more

80=100%
x=62%

You divide the ones with the same units

x/80 = 62%/100% (write those as fractions if you have to show any work)
x=49.6

60=100%
x=70%

x/60 = 70/100
x=42

A square pool has a side length of x feet.A uniform border around pool is 1 footwide.The total area of the pool and the border o
lions [1.4K]
The total area of pool and border = 361  square feet.

Length of square pool = x

Length of square pool plus border =  (x + 1 +1 ) = x + 2

There is 1 foot length on each side on the x  length.

The other length of the square pool and border =  (x + 2)

Area = (x+2)(x+2)

     (x + 2)(x +2) =  361.            Let A = x +2

        A*A = 361
            A²  = 361    Take square root of both sides
             A  = √361
               A = 19

A = x + 2 = 19
       x = 19 - 2
       x = 17

Area of square pool = x*x = 17*17 = 289

Area of the pool = 289 square feet.

Ray needs help creating the second part of the coaster. Create a unique parabola in the pattern f(x) = (x − a)(x − b). Describe
MatroZZZ [7]

Answer:

1) The parabola equation faces up

2) The y-intercept = a·b

3) The zeros are x = a and x = b

Step-by-step explanation:

1) The given information are;

f(x) = (x - a)·(x - b) which gives;

f(x) = x² - (b+a)·x + a·b

For an equation of the form a·x² - b·x + c, if a is positive, then the parabola faces up, therefore, the parabola equation, x² - (b+a)·x + ab where a is equivalent to +1 faces up

2) The y-intercept is given at x = 0, which gives;

f(0) = 0² - (b+a)·0 + a·b

The y-intercept = a·b

3) From f(x) = (x - a)·(x - b), when f(x) = 0, we have either;

(x - a) = 0 or (x - b) = 0

Therefore;

The zeros are x = a and x = b
